What You'll Achieve.
utilize Commercial Risk Rating Models and Loss forecasting models for credit risk management or other enterprise initiatives; ensure compliance of models to all regulations; Monitor and report on performance of all models; ensure Rating models are fully integrated into the appropriate platform; ensure independent validation is scheduled; ensure that accurate and appropriate ratings are assigned; Define, develop and deploy best credit risk practices and infrastructure bank wide; maintain M&T internal control standards; Risk Ratings are utilized in many areas of the bank and are a key driver of many enterprise level decisions; mission critical information that is utilized internally across the organization and externally by the Bank Examiners, Outside Accountants, rating agencies and the investment community; ratings are also a key input into the loss forecasting models utilized for the CCAR process; Loss Forecasting models are used in Capital Plan submissions that are a critical component of sound Bank management and are subject to regulatory scrutiny under DFAST regulations

What You'll Do.
long-term strategic design
testing and use of Commercial Risk Rating Models and Loss forecasting models
sets the strategic direction for the process of continuous enhancements
Development and Maintenance of the framework for Commercial PD and LGD credit risk models
Development and Maintenance of assigned Commercial Loss Forecasting and Stress Testing models
Ensure compliance of models to all regulations
Monitor and report on performance of all models
Determine when redevelopment or recalibration is needed
Conduct internal validation and back testing of all models
Manage the output of Quantitative Analysts and Modelers
track the development of their statistical modeling acumen
Develop and maintain a regimen of training to all users of the Rating scorecards
Consult with internal businesses with the ongoing management and validation of their scores and score-based strategies
Specify and model the relationship between appropriate macroeconomic factors and credit risk outcomes
Develop strategies and techniques for modeling commercial credit risk in areas new to the organization
Analyze and present findings to Senior Management
develop and deploy best credit risk practices and infrastructure bank wide
Execute ad hoc analysis or projects assigned by the Credit Risk Manager
Adhere to applicable compliance/operational risk controls
Maintain M&T internal control standards
Complete other related duties as assigned
